Latest Patents

One of his latest patents is a method for determining the reference focal position of a laser beam. This method involves producing at least two incisions in a plate-like member using a laser beam set at different focal positions. The process includes irradiating the plate-like member, detecting edges of the incisions by measuring parameters related to the irradiation, and establishing the width of the incisions based on the detected parameters.

Another significant patent by Zimmermann is related to marking a workpiece with a data matrix code using a laser beam. This invention describes methods and apparatuses for marking a data matrix code in the form of an n*m cell matrix of light and dark cells. The laser processing unit directs the laser beam onto the workpiece, scanning the region to be marked with a constant marking speed and alternately in opposite directions. The light and dark pixels are marked on the workpiece by temporarily switching on the laser beam during the scan.

Career Highlights

Markus Zimmermann has worked with prominent companies in the laser technology sector, including Trumpf Werkzeugmaschinen GmbH + Co. KG and Trumpf Laser- und Systemtechnik GmbH. His experience in these organizations has contributed to his development as an inventor and innovator in the field.
